NHL: Nashville 5, Los Angeles 4

NASHVILLE, Nov. 25 (UPI) -- Steve Sullivan registered a goal and added an assist Thursday night as Nashville edged the Los Angeles Kings, 4-3.

Marek Zidlicky had three assists and Adam Hall scored once for Nashville (13-3-3), which has won six of its last seven games. Goaltender Tomas Vokoun stopped 35 of the 38 shots he faced.

Derek Armstrong scored twice, Jeremy Roenick, Tim Gleason, Sean Avery, Craig Conroy, Lubomir Visnovsky and Alexander Frolov all assisted once, and goalie Jason LaBarbera made 29 saves for the Kings (15-7-1), who had a three-game winning streak snapped.

Los Angeles outshot the Predators, 38-33. The Kings went scoreless on five power-play opportunities while Nashville was 1-for-4.

The Predators' Paul Kariya was denied on a penalty shot late in the second period.
